Object.defineProperty(exports, "__esModule", { value: true });
exports.BshbMotionLightsHandler = void 0;
const bshb_handler_1 = require("./bshb-handler");
const rxjs_1 = require("rxjs");
const bshb_definition_1 = require("../../bshb-definition");
class BshbMotionLightsHandler extends bshb_handler_1.BshbHandler {
regex = /bshb\.\d+\.motionlight\.(.*)/;
cachedStates = new Map();
handleDetection() {
return this.detectMotionLights().pipe((0, rxjs_1.tap)({
subscribe: () => this.bshb.log.info('Start detecting motion lights...'),
finalize: () => this.bshb.log.info('Detecting motion lights finished'),
}));
}
handleBshcUpdate(resultEntry) {
if (resultEntry['@type'] === 'motionlight') {
const idPrefix = `motionlight.${resultEntry.id}`;
Object.keys(resultEntry).forEach(key => {
const id = `${idPrefix}.${key}`;
(0, rxjs_1.from)(this.bshb.getObjectAsync(id))
.pipe((0, rxjs_1.switchMap)(obj => {
if (obj) {
this.bshb.setState(id, {
val: this.mapValueToStorage(resultEntry[key]),
ack: true,
});
return (0, rxjs_1.of)(undefined);
}
else {
return this.importState(key, resultEntry);
}
}))
.subscribe(this.handleBshcUpdateError(`id=${resultEntry.id}`));
});
return true;
}
return false;
}
sendUpdateToBshc(id, state) {
const match = this.regex.exec(id);
let result = (0, rxjs_1.of)(false);
if (match) {
const cachedState = this.cachedStates.get(id);
const data = {};
result = this.mapValueFromStorage(id, state.val)
.pipe((0, rxjs_1.map)(mappedValue => (data[cachedState.key] = mappedValue)), (0, rxjs_1.switchMap)(() => this.getBshcClient().updateMotionLights(cachedState.id, data, {
timeout: this.long_timeout,
})))
.pipe((0, rxjs_1.tap)(this.handleBshcSendError(`id=${match[1]}, value=${state.val}`)), (0, rxjs_1.map)(() => true));
}
return result;
}
detectMotionLights() {
return this.setObjectNotExistsAsync('motionlight', {
type: 'folder',
common: {
name: 'motionlight',
read: true,
},
native: {},
}).pipe((0, rxjs_1.switchMap)(() => this.getBshcClient().getMotionLights({ timeout: this.long_timeout })), (0, rxjs_1.mergeMap)(response => (0, rxjs_1.from)(response.parsedResponse)), (0, rxjs_1.mergeMap)(waterLight => this.addMotionLight(waterLight)), (0, rxjs_1.switchMap)(() => (0, rxjs_1.of)(undefined)));
}
addMotionLight(motionLight) {
return this.getBshcClient()
.getDevice(motionLight.id)
.pipe((0, rxjs_1.map)(response => response.parsedResponse), (0, rxjs_1.switchMap)(device => this.setObjectNotExistsAsync(`motionlight.${motionLight.id}`, {
type: 'channel',
common: {
name: device ? device.name : motionLight.id,
},
native: {},
})), (0, rxjs_1.mergeMap)(() => (0, rxjs_1.from)(Object.keys(motionLight))), (0, rxjs_1.mergeMap)(key => this.importState(key, motionLight)));
}
importState(key, motionLight) {
if (key === '@type' || key === 'id' || key === 'motionDetectorId') {
return (0, rxjs_1.of)(undefined);
}
const id = `motionlight.${motionLight.id}.${key}`;
const value = motionLight[key];
this.cachedStates.set(`${this.bshb.namespace}.${id}`, {
id: motionLight.id,
key: key,
});
return this.setObjectNotExistsAsync(id, {
type: 'state',
common: {
name: key,
type: bshb_definition_1.BshbDefinition.determineType(value),
role: bshb_definition_1.BshbDefinition.determineRole('motionlight', key, value),
read: true,
write: true,
},
native: {},
}).pipe((0, rxjs_1.switchMap)(() => (0, rxjs_1.from)(this.bshb.getStateAsync(id))), (0, rxjs_1.switchMap)(state => this.setInitialStateValueIfNotSet(id, state, value)));
}
name() {
return 'motionLightsHandler';
}
}
exports.BshbMotionLightsHandler = BshbMotionLightsHandler;
